The close relations between statistical properties of quantum dissipative systems and scattering systems is discussed. It is conjectured that for quantum chaotic scattering the distribution of the resonance poles of the S matrix is generic and follows the predictions of the Ginibre ensemble of random non-Hermitian matrices. This phenomenon has been demosntrated on a simple example of a single particle scattered by eight randomly distributed point obstacles in three dimensions.
